What Are Bug Bombs?
Bug bombs, also known as foggers, release a pesticide mist that fills a room to kill insects. They are often used for cockroaches, ants, and other common pests. The idea is that the fog reaches all the nooks and crannies where bugs hide.
Do Bug Bombs Actually Kill Fruit Flies?
From my experience, bug bombs can kill fruit flies that are flying or resting in exposed areas during the treatment. However, fruit flies often breed inside drains, garbage bins, or on rotting fruit—places where the fog might not penetrate deeply. So while bug bombs reduce the number of adult flies temporarily, they might not eliminate the entire infestation.
Pros of Using Bug Bombs for Fruit Flies
- Easy to use with just one activation
- Kills adult fruit flies on contact in open spaces
- Can cover an entire room quickly
Cons of Using Bug Bombs for Fruit Flies
- Doesn’t reach larvae or eggs hidden in fruit or drains
- Requires vacating the area during treatment
- Chemicals may linger and affect indoor air quality
- Not a long-term solution for fruit fly infestations
What I Recommend Instead
After seeing limited results with bug bombs, I found better success focusing on source control:
- Removing overripe fruit and cleaning spills immediately
- Using apple cider vinegar traps to catch adult flies
- Cleaning drains with baking soda and vinegar or specialized drain cleaners
- Keeping garbage sealed and taken out regularly
When to Consider Bug Bombs
If you have a severe infestation involving multiple pests, bug bombs might help reduce overall insect populations temporarily. But for fruit flies alone, I see them as a supplementary option rather than a primary solution.
